.idx-banner{position:relative}.idx-banner img{display:block;width:100%;min-height:200px;object-fit:cover}.idx-banner .container{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);color:#fff;z-index:11}.idx-banner .title{text-align:center}.idx-banner .info,.idx-banner .btn{display:none}.idx-banner .swiper-pagination{position:absolute;left:50%;bottom:10px;transform:translateX(-50%);display:block}.idx-banner .swiper-pagination-bullet:not(.swiper-pagination-bullet-active){background:#FFF;opacity:.53}.idx-banner .swiper-pagination-bullet-active{background:rgba(255,255,255,.8);border:1px solid #FFF}@media (min-width:768px){.idx-banner img{min-height:350px}.idx-banner .container>*{max-width:620px}.idx-banner .title{text-align:left}.idx-banner .info{display:block;line-height:1.8;margin-top:5px;margin-bottom:15px}.idx-banner .btn{width:180px;display:flex;align-items:center;justify-content:center;border-radius:6px;background:var(--style-color)}.idx-banner .btn i{font-size:26px;line-height:1;margin-left:10px}}@media (min-width:1200px){.idx-banner .info{margin-top:15px;margin-bottom:35px}.idx-banner .btn{width:224px;padding:11px 15px;transition:opacity .3s}.idx-banner .btn:hover{opacity:.8}.idx-banner .btn i{margin-left:19px}.idx-banner .swiper-pagination{bottom:40px}}@media (min-width:1640px){.idx-banner .info{margin-bottom:54px}}@media (max-width:640px){.idx-banner .title{font-size:18px}}.idx-products .info-group{padding:20px 15px;background:#FAFAFA}.idx-products .title{text-align:left;margin-bottom:10px}.idx-products .info{max-height:87px;line-height:1.8;margin-bottom:20px}.idx-products .btn{width:180px;color:#fff;display:flex;align-items:center;justify-content:center;border-radius:6px;background:var(--style-color)}.idx-products .btn i{font-size:26px;line-height:1;margin-left:10px}@media (min-width:768px){.idx-products .item{display:flex}.idx-products .item:nth-child(even){flex-direction:row-reverse}.idx-products .item>*{flex:0 0 50%;max-width:50%}.idx-products .info-group{padding:8px 30px;display:flex;flex-direction:column;justify-content:center}}@media (min-width:1200px){.idx-products .info-group{padding-left:60px;padding-right:60px}.idx-products .title{margin-bottom:19px}.idx-products .info{max-height:116px;margin-bottom:40px}.idx-products .btn{width:230px;padding:11px 15px;transition:opacity .3s}.idx-products .btn:hover{opacity:.8}.idx-products .btn i{margin-left:19px}}@media (min-width:1440px){.idx-products .info-group{padding-left:100px;padding-right:100px}}@media (min-width:1640px){.idx-products .info-group{padding-left:160px;padding-right:160px}.idx-products .title{font-size:30px}.idx-products .info{margin-bottom:75px}}@media (min-width:1840px){.idx-products .item:nth-child(odd) .info-group{padding-right:calc(160px + 15px - 5px / 2)}.idx-products .item:nth-child(even) .info-group{padding-left:calc(160px + 15px - 5px / 2)}}.idx-services{padding:30px 0;background:#FAFAFA}.idx-services .lt{margin-bottom:20px}.idx-services img{display:none}.idx-services .sub-title{color:var(--style-color);margin-bottom:8px}.idx-services .title{text-align:left;margin-bottom:15px}.idx-services .info{max-height:288px}.idx-services .info>*:first-child{margin-top:0}.idx-services .info p{line-height:1.8}.idx-services .info p:not(:last-child){margin-bottom:1.8em}.idx-services .info h3{color:var(--style-color);text-align:left;margin-top:15px;margin-bottom:9px}.idx-services .item-list li{padding:15px 20px 15px 60px;font-weight:700;border-radius:6px;background:rgba(237,9,145,.04);border:2px solid rgba(237,9,145,.11);position:relative}.idx-services .item-list li:not(:last-child){margin-bottom:15px}.idx-services .item-list img{position:absolute;top:-2px;left:-2px;width:50px;display:block}.idx-services .num{position:absolute;left:6px;top:10px;line-height:1;color:#fff}@media (min-width:992px){.idx-services .container{display:flex;align-items:center}.idx-services .lt{flex:0 0 50%;max-width:50%;padding-right:15px;margin-bottom:0}.idx-services .rt{flex:0 0 50%;max-width:50%;padding-left:15px}.idx-services .info{max-height:200px}}@media (min-width:1200px){.idx-services{padding:92px 0 110px;position:relative}.idx-services img{display:block;position:absolute}.idx-services .img-lt{top:0;left:0;width:12.9%}.idx-services .img-bottom{left:19.8%;bottom:0;width:28%}.idx-services .container{position:relative;z-index:1}.idx-services .lt{padding-right:60px}.idx-services .info h3{font-size:20px;margin-top:33px}.idx-services .item-list li{padding:26px 30px 25px 70px}.idx-services .item-list li:not(:last-child){margin-bottom:31px}.idx-services .item-list img{width:60px}.idx-services .info{max-height:360px}}@media (min-width:1440px){.idx-services .lt{padding-right:80px}}@media (min-width:1640px){.idx-services .lt{padding-right:120px}.idx-services .info{max-height:399px}.idx-services .item-list li{font-size:30px;padding-left:108px}.idx-services .item-list img{width:69px}}.idx-about{padding:30px 0}.idx-about .img-lt,.idx-about .img-rt{display:none}.idx-about .lt{margin-bottom:20px}.idx-about .sub-title{color:var(--style-color);margin-bottom:8px}.idx-about .title{text-align:left;margin-bottom:15px}.idx-about .info{line-height:1.8;max-height:202px}.idx-about .info p:not(:last-child){margin-bottom:1.8em}.idx-about .btn{width:180px;color:#fff;margin-top:20px;display:flex;align-items:center;justify-content:center;border-radius:6px;background:var(--style-color)}.idx-about .btn i{font-size:26px;line-height:1;margin-left:10px}@media (min-width:992px){.idx-about .container{display:flex;align-items:center;justify-content:flex-start}.idx-about .lt{flex:0 0 50%;max-width:50%;padding-right:15px;margin-bottom:0}.idx-about .rt{flex:0 0 50%;max-width:50%;padding-left:15px}.idx-about .info{max-height:116px}}@media (min-width:1200px){.idx-about{padding:98px 0 92px;position:relative}.idx-about .img-rt{position:absolute;right:0;bottom:0;width:21%;display:block}.idx-about .container{position:relative;z-index:1}.idx-about .lt{position:relative}.idx-about .lt img:not(.img-lt){position:relative;z-index:1}.idx-about .img-lt{position:absolute;top:0;left:0;transform:scale(1.2);display:block}.idx-about .rt{padding-left:60px}.idx-about .info{max-height:144px}.idx-about .btn{width:230px;margin-top:40px;padding:11px 15px;transition:opacity .3s}.idx-about .btn:hover{opacity:.8}.idx-about .btn i{margin-left:19px}}@media (min-width:1440px){.idx-about .rt{padding-left:80px}.idx-about .info{max-height:202px}}@media (min-width:1640px){.idx-about .lt{padding-right:44px}.idx-about .img-lt{top:-15px;left:-5px}.idx-about .rt{padding-left:120px}.idx-about .info{max-height:317px}.idx-about .btn{margin-top:70px}}.whyChooseUs{padding:30px 0;background:#FAFAFA}.whyChooseUs .icon{height:60px}.whyChooseUs .icon img{width:auto;height:100%}.whyChooseUs .sub-title{color:var(--style-color);text-align:center;margin-bottom:12px}.whyChooseUs .title{margin-bottom:17px}.whyChooseUs .sub-info{line-height:1.8;text-align:center}.whyChooseUs .btn{width:180px;color:#fff;margin-top:20px;margin-left:auto;margin-right:auto;display:flex;align-items:center;justify-content:center;border-radius:6px;background:var(--style-color)}.whyChooseUs .btn i{font-size:26px;line-height:1;margin-left:10px}.whyChooseUs .item-wrap>img{display:none}.whyChooseUs .item-list{margin-top:20px;margin-bottom:-20px}.whyChooseUs .item-list li{padding:30px 15px;background:#fff;border-radius:6px;margin-bottom:20px;border:2px solid var(--style-color)}.whyChooseUs .tit{font-weight:700;margin-top:15px;margin-bottom:5px}.whyChooseUs .info{line-height:1.8;max-height:87px}@media (min-width:640px){.whyChooseUs .item-list{display:flex;flex-wrap:wrap;margin-left:-10px;margin-right:-10px}.whyChooseUs .item-list li{flex:0 0 calc(50% - 20px);max-width:calc(50% - 20px);margin-left:10px;margin-right:10px}}@media (min-width:1200px){.whyChooseUs{padding:60px 0 92px}.whyChooseUs .btn{width:230px;margin-top:31px;padding:11px 15px;transition:opacity .3s}.whyChooseUs .btn:hover{opacity:.8}.whyChooseUs .btn i{margin-left:19px}.whyChooseUs .item-wrap{position:relative}.whyChooseUs .item-wrap>img{display:block;position:absolute}.whyChooseUs .img-lt{top:0;left:0;transform:translate(-43%,-40%);width:27%}.whyChooseUs .img-rt{right:0;bottom:0;transform:translate(40%,30%);width:22%}.whyChooseUs .item-list{margin-top:36px;margin-left:-17px;margin-right:-17px;position:relative;z-index:1}.whyChooseUs .item-list li{flex:0 0 calc(33.33% - 34px);max-width:calc(33.33% - 34px);margin-left:17px;margin-right:17px;padding:45px 30px}.whyChooseUs .icon{height:76px}.whyChooseUs .tit{margin-top:28px;margin-bottom:10px}}@media (min-width:1640px){.whyChooseUs{padding-top:86px}.whyChooseUs .sub-info{max-width:1400px;margin-left:auto;margin-right:auto}}.idx-blog{padding:30px 0;position:relative}.idx-blog>img{display:none}.idx-blog .sub-title{color:var(--style-color);text-align:center;margin-bottom:5px}.idx-blog .title{margin-bottom:20px}.idx-blog .swiper-container{margin:-11px -8px -14px -11px;padding:11px 8px 14px 11px}.idx-blog .swiper-slide{padding-bottom:20px;border-radius:6px;background:#fff;border:2px solid var(--style-color);box-shadow:0 3px 10px 1px rgba(237,9,145,.16)}.idx-blog .scale-img{margin-top:-2px;margin-left:-2px;margin-right:-2px;border-radius:6px 6px 0 0}.idx-blog .scale-img img{width:100%}.idx-blog .swiper-slide>*:not(.scale-img){margin-left:15px;margin-right:15px}.idx-blog .tit{margin-top:15px;margin-bottom:7px;font-weight:700}.idx-blog .info{height:116px;line-height:1.8}.idx-blog .btn-wrap{margin-top:12px;display:flex;align-items:center;justify-content:space-between}.idx-blog .btn{padding:0;color:var(--style-color)}.idx-blog .date{color:#999}@media (min-width:768px){.idx-blog .swiper-wrap{position:relative}.idx-blog .prev-btn,.idx-blog .next-btn{width:40px;height:40px;font-size:24px;border-radius:50%;background:rgba(255,255,255,.8);box-shadow:0 3px 6px 1px rgba(0,0,0,.16);display:flex;align-items:center;justify-content:center}.idx-blog .prev-btn{transform:translate(-50%,-50%)}.idx-blog .next-btn{transform:translate(50%,-50%)}}@media (min-width:1200px){.idx-blog{padding:86px 0 92px}.idx-blog>img{display:block;position:absolute}.idx-blog .img-lt{top:0;left:0;width:25.57%}.idx-blog .img-rt{right:0;bottom:0;width:28%}.idx-blog .container{position:relative;z-index:1}.idx-blog .sub-title{margin-bottom:11px}.idx-blog .title{margin-bottom:22px}.idx-blog .swiper-slide{padding-bottom:35px}.idx-blog .swiper-slide>*:not(.scale-img){margin-left:30px;margin-right:30px}.idx-blog .tit{margin-top:25px}.idx-blog .btn:hover{text-decoration:underline}.idx-blog .prev-btn,.idx-blog .next-btn{width:50px;height:50px;font-size:26px}}.idx-contact{padding:30px 0;background:#FAFAFA}.idx-contact .rt img{display:none}.idx-contact .form-wrap{color:#fff;background:#000}.idx-contact .title{text-align:left;margin-bottom:11px}.idx-contact .info{line-height:1.8;margin-bottom:10px}.idx-contact .sub-tit{padding-top:10px;font-weight:700;border-top:2px solid rgba(255,255,255,.8);margin-bottom:18px}.idx-contact .form-wrap{padding:30px 20px}.idx-contact .form-group{margin-bottom:20px}.idx-contact .form-control{border-color:#999}.idx-contact .btn-wrap{margin-top:20px}.idx-contact .btn{width:100%;color:#fff;font-size:20px;border-radius:6px;background:var(--style-color)}.idx-contact .form-control::-webkit-input-placeholder{color:#333}.idx-contact .form-control:-moz-placeholder{color:#333}.idx-contact .form-control::-moz-placeholder{color:#333}.idx-contact .form-control:-ms-input-placeholder{color:#333}@media (min-width:992px){.idx-contact .container{display:flex;justify-content:space-between}.idx-contact .lt{flex:0 0 51.25%;max-width:51.25%}.idx-contact .rt{flex:0 0 calc(48.75% - 30px);max-width:calc(48.75% - 30px);margin-left:30px}.idx-contact .form-wrap{height:100%}}@media (min-width:1200px){.idx-contact{padding:70px 0}.idx-contact .lt{position:relative;z-index:1}.idx-contact .rt{position:relative}.idx-contact .rt img{position:absolute;top:0;left:0;width:100%;transform:scale(1.45) translate(1%,8%);display:block}.idx-contact .form-wrap{padding:40px 30px;position:relative;z-index:1}.idx-contact .info{margin-bottom:25px}.idx-contact .sub-tit{padding-top:26px}.idx-contact input.form-control{height:50px}.idx-contact .btn-wrap{margin-top:30px}.idx-contact .btn{font-size:24px;padding-top:11px;padding-bottom:11px;transition:opacity .3s}.idx-contact .btn:hover{opacity:.8}}@media (min-width:1440px){.idx-contact .rt{flex:0 0 calc(48.75% - 50px);max-width:calc(48.75% - 50px);margin-left:50px}}@media (min-width:1640px){.idx-contact .rt{flex:0 0 calc(48.75% - 80px);max-width:calc(48.75% - 80px);margin-left:80px}.idx-contact .form-wrap{padding:50px 53px}}